    The Morning After The Blizzard in Chicago

     

    It wasn't traffic jams or crowded buses that dominated the morning rush hour in Chicago today. Instead, it was empty expressways and almost-commuter-free downtown trains as the city was waking up to its biggest snow day in more than a decade.
    When I walked out and headed into the city early this morning, I could only hear silence - broken only by the wind gusts and the occasional vehicle as the city was obviously not going to work as usual.
    It seemed like the Loop and the Gold Coast were getting a break in the morning routine, with the exception of the few coffee shops where dozens huddled - many with cameras (like me) to document this historic snowfall.
    As I was waiting for my cup, I could hear someone say "Happy Groundhog Day!" How could I forget?
